Has thought been given to using the prior NYSESLATs writing rubrics on the writing subtest in order to maintain continuity of rating?

0

A. The rubrics for prior NYSESLAT tests cannot be used in place of the rubrics developed for the 2005 NYSESLAT. To use the prior rubrics would be a misadministration of the test. Harcourts psychometric staff will equate the 2005 NYSESLAT to the prior NYSESLAT tests.
